The Opportunity
EPEC Group is seeking a motivated and technically capable SCADA & Control Systems Engineer to join our growing operations team. In this role, you will lead and deliver substation SCADA and communications solutions across high‐voltage and renewable energy projects—playing a key part in enabling Australia's energy transition. This is a hands‐on role with exposure across the full project lifecycle, including design, testing, site integration, and commissioning.
Key Responsibilities
SCADA & Communications
* Lead the design, development, and delivery of substation SCADA and communications systems
* Develop functional descriptions, schematics, IO/points list, and control system documentation
* Conduct bench testing, FAT/SAT, and Proof of Concept testing
* Work closely with TNSPs, AEMO, and clients to ensure compliance
* Support AVR control systems development and optimization
* Identify opportunities for system optimization and value engineering
